Recombinant host cell for biosynthetic production
A cell may include heterologous polynucleotides encoding a multienzyme complex involved in the metabolic pathway of phenylpropanoids and biosynthesis of a vanilloid or a hydroxybenzaldehyde precursor thereof, which multienzyme complex comprises enzymes for the biosynthesis of coumaric acid and a crotonase.
COMPOSITIONS OF PROKARYOTIC PHENYLALANINE AMMONIA-LYASE VARIANTS AND METHODS OF USING COMPOSITIONS THEREOF
Provided herein are phenylalanine ammonia-lyase (PAL) variants produced by prokaryotes, wherein such prokaryotic PAL variant has a greater phenylalanine-converting activity and/or a reduced immunogenicity as compared to a wild-type PAL. Further provided are compositions of prokaryotic PAL and biologically active fragments, mutants, variants or analogs thereof, as well as methods for the production, purification, formulation, and use of such compositions for industrial and therapeutic purposes, e.g., treating hyperphenylalaninemia, including phenylketonuria, and other disorders, including cancer.

METHODS FOR PRODUCING VANILLA PLANTS WITH IMPROVED FLAVOR AND AGRONOMIC PRODUCTION
Provided herein are methods for improving various traits in plants, such as in Vanilla sp. plants, by genetically-modifying the genome of plants, introducing heterologous sequences into the plants, or breeding plants with selected alleles. Such traits that can be improved by the methods and compositions of the present invention include an increase in levels of vanillin or one or more precursors thereof, reducing dehiscence, reducing the size of a rostellum or eliminating its presence, and increasing fungal resistance. Also disclosed herein are genetically-modified plants, extract from such plants or plant parts thereof, and methods of producing such plants or progeny thereof.
BIOPRODUCTION OF ENANTIOPURE (R)- AND (S)-2-PHENYLGLYCINOL FROM STYRENE AND RENEWABLE FEEDSTOCKS VIA ARTIFICIAL ENZYME CASCADE
Disclosed herein are methods of bioproduction of enantiomerically pure or enantiomerically enriched 2-phenylglycinol or a derivative thereof by multiple enzyme-catalyzed chemical transformations in a one-pot reaction system.
